The Power of Heavy-Duty Electrical Transformers: Strength, Capacity, and Reliability

2Views

Electrical transformers for heavy duty applications are built to manage high amounts of electrical power in harsh settings. Intended for operation under high loads and steady performance these transformers are widely utilised in industrial plants, power plants and large infrastructure projects. Because of their rugged structure and sophisticated engineering, they play a vital role in guaranteeing dependable power distribution in applications where conventional transformers may not be up to the task.

High Load Capacity & Industrial Performance

huge-duty transformers are known for their ability to handle high voltage and huge electrical loads without loss in efficiency. They are constructed with high grade core materials, effective cooling systems and strong insulation for sustained operation. This enables them to flourish in contexts such as manufacturing plants, mining operations and huge commercial buildings where uninterruptible power supply is vital.

Advanced Engineering and Longevit

Heavy-duty transformers are built to last, often with reinforced construction to endure hard environments including excessive temperatures, moisture and dust. And many have improved cooling measures , including being filled with oil or having air conditioning , so they do not overheat during continuous usage .

Modern designs also feature monitoring systems that track performance, detect issues and enable for preventive maintenance. This not only increases the life time of the transformer but also minimises the chances of sudden failure. This makes it a reliable solution for high demand applications.

Supporting Infrastructure and Energy Systems

These transformers are crucial for maintaining national grid systems and huge infrastructure networks. They are used for transmitting the electricity generated by the power stations over large distances and supplying it to industries and metropolitan regions at useable voltage levels.

Heavy-duty transformers are also growing in importance in renewable energy projects, helping connect vast solar farms and wind power plants to the grid. They help improve the stability and efficiency of the energy system by controlling the variation of voltage and assuring the stable power flow.
